Output 756a7777c958e6f9da4c17502260d0d808c0ea600d7405ce5501023211ecd059:2

value
333000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059bb8ce82dc496f3821acca29dead854f4bf91b OP_EQUAL
address
32CfrFUBtnbLamei7SXZLLFSpryXyTBrqV
transaction
756a7777c958e6f9da4c17502260d0d808c0ea600d7405ce5501023211ecd059
spent
true